NY Judge Limits Madison Square Garden Atty Ban

A Manhattan state judge issued a clarifying order Friday in a lawsuit challenging Madison Square Garden's policy of banning lawyers involved in litigation against the company from its venues, saying that under civil rights law, the ban can apply to sporting events but that concert tickets can't be revoked after the doors open.

Ex-GPB Capital CEO Loses Wiretap Fight In Fraud Case

A Brooklyn federal judge has denied a motion by GPB Capital Holdings' former CEO to produce recordings obtained by a former corporate attorney who wore a wire as part of a government investigation that led to charges of a $1.8 billion fraud scheme.
